The Western Marine Command of the Nigerian Customs Service, Lagos, has handed over three suspects and 1,658 loaves of canabis sativa, weighing 788kg, to the National Drug Law Enforcement Agency, NDLEA.
The Customs Area Controller, Western Marine Command, Comptroller Paul Bamisaiye, while briefing newsmen, handed the narcotics and suspects over to the new NDLEA Commander, Western Marine Command, Mr Udoh Morrison.
